My inky rendition depicts that period of time just after dusk. I can hear softly hooting owls in the trees talking to one another, the chirping of happy insects announcing the full moon, croaking toads and frogs in search of goodies, and perhaps even some "night owls" doing their crafting!


I printed out The Great Horned Owl digital set TWICE. 

One owl was fussy cut to make a mask. The other was colored with Copic Markers. This is one of the colored images included in the digital set.
After die cutting a circle and placing it on top of the owl mask, I used distress inks in Black Soot, Blueprint, and Stormy Sky to create a night sky.


The frame process:
(if you are reading this on my personal blog, click on the photos to enlarge)



  1. Applied a double sided Adhesive Sheet to black cardstock, leaving "rough" protective layer in place.
  2. After die cutting shape, I removed the protective layer and burnished in Black Microfine Glitter (if you prefer, use black glittery EP instead).
  3. I distressed with VersaMark Ink here and there and applied a gold-and-black Chunky Opaque embossing powder.  Then I added a bit of chunky Black embossing powder on top of the gold color, to tone down the gold. Glittery green embossing powder was also used in the distressing process. Heat a little at a time so it does not melt the double sided adhesive sheet.
  4. I die cut some white fun foam in the same shape, and edged it with a black Sharpie marker. The black frame was then adhered to the fun foam for dimension, using Double Sided Tape.


    I thoroughly enjoy "distressing" with glitters and embossing powders!
    frame close up:

    The set comes with a leafy twig - great for framing or using around the branch. Because this set was once available in rubber, I embossing the twig with more Green embossing powder to give the leaves a night time appearance. Any twig stamp will work.

    The sentiment was stamped with Nocturne VersaFine Clair and heat set with Black Detail embossing powder. It was distressed with the same colors as the sky background.


    The Handmade paper was dry embossed and distressed with 3 colors of mousse.

    For the monochrome card, I heat set gold EP. A few colors of distress inks were applied in a resist technique for shading. To maintain "STRAIGHT" lines with the inks, I used a 1" mask. The decorative frame is gold glossy cardstock:



    For some of the angles, a mask was used to keep the distressed coloring in straight lines:



    Using multiple masks, I next colored using distress inks and finger daubers achieving a Fall colored, patch-work quilt look with the same stamp:



    Coloring with Masks can be fun, creative and most of all, mistake-proof!



    The masking was made easy by using 1-inch "post-it note" tape.

    To make this fun card, I started by using one of the beautiful backgrounds available from the Lavinia World artist. It is a 5 x 7.5" card, and I trimmed it to 5x5 by cutting 2.5" off the top, after altering the color of the background by using a finger dauber and Aged Mahogany Distress ink:


    Choosing a pinky salmon scrap of cardstock and VersaFine Clair Acorn Brown ink, I stamped the house and heat set it with clear detail detail EP.  After the ink dried, it was fussy cut. Highlights were added with Zig Cartoonist Brush Pen - White.


    Before adhering the house, Stars Miniature was stamped with VersaFine Clair Nocturne ink. Also with black ink, Leaf 2 Miniature and Creeping Vine (upside-down) were added and heat set with a copper EP containing glitter.

    Finally the fairies were stamped and heat set with black detail EP:
